Charles Schwab to launch direct bitcoin, ether trading to compete with Robinhood
Charles Schwab is entering the cryptocurrency market by allowing its clients to trade bitcoin and ether directly. This move is seen as a strategic effort to compete with platforms like Robinhood that have popularized crypto trading. The availability of these digital assets could attract more clients seeking diversified trading options. Schwab's entry may also lead to increased legitimacy and broader acceptance of cryptocurrencies in traditional investing. Investor interest is likely to surge, impacting related sectors and stocks.

Robinhood, Webull jump after US SEC approves removal of day-trading limit for smaller investors
The US SEC's decision to remove the day-trading limit for smaller investors has led to an uptick in trading platforms like Robinhood and Webull. This regulatory change could potentially increase trading volume among retail investors, thereby boosting revenues for these platforms. Analysts believe this move could encourage more active trading and market participation. The news has been well-received in the market, reflecting bullish sentiment towards these companies. Overall, the removal of the limit is likely to enhance liquidity and volatility in the markets, favoring active traders.
